The Northwestern Hawaiian Islands stretch across more than 1,200 nautical miles northwest of the main Hawaiian Islands, and encompass almost 70 percent of the coral reefs under United States control. They may be America's last opportunity to protect a nearly intact coral reef ecosystem, and to repair the damage inflicted to date.

Right now, plans are being drafted to establish the Northwestern Hawaiian Islands as a National Marine Sanctuary. Sadly, however, many of the existing U.S. national marine sanctuaries have so far proven insufficient to protect the species and habitats within from the adverse effects of overfishing, pollution, poorly managed tourism, and other activities. If the same approach is taken in the Northwestern Hawaiian Islands, damage to this nearly pristine coral ecosystem is virtually inevitable.
